- Atmosphere and setting: The series convincingly recreates small-town northern India—its politics, caste dynamics, and criminal undercurrents—giving the story weight and context.
- Plot momentum: The rise-and-fall arc moves briskly, with enough incidents—betrayals, showdowns, courtroom drama—to keep viewers engaged across episodes.
- Supporting cast: Strong turns from supporting actors flesh out the world and add moral ambiguity; some characters aren’t simply villains or victims, which enriches the drama.
